LINUX.ORG.RU
ФорумAdmin

freeradius mysql в chroot

 , , , ,


1

1

Freeradius установлен в chroot.

В логах появлянтся:

root@srv:/# tail /var/log/freeradius/radius.log
Wed Jan 14 04:47:26 2015 : Info: rlm_sql (sql): Attempting to connect to root@localhost:3306/radius
Wed Jan 14 04:47:26 2015 : Info: rlm_sql (sql): Attempting to connect rlm_sql_mysql #0
Wed Jan 14 04:47:26 2015 : Info: rlm_sql_mysql: Starting connect to MySQL server for #0
Wed Jan 14 04:47:26 2015 : Error: rlm_sql_mysql: Couldn't connect socket to MySQL server root@localhost:radius
Wed Jan 14 04:47:26 2015 : Error: rlm_sql_mysql: Mysql error '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(13)'
Wed Jan 14 04:47:26 2015 : Error: rlm_sql (sql): Failed to connect DB handle #0
Wed Jan 14 04:47:26 2015 : Info: Loaded virtual server <default>
Wed Jan 14 04:47:26 2015 : Info: Loaded virtual server inner-tunnel
Wed Jan 14 04:47:26 2015 : Info:  ... adding new socket proxy address * port 60861
Wed Jan 14 04:47:26 2015 : Info: Ready to process requests.
root@srv:/#

как исправить

★★★★★

Мускуль в том-же чруте? Если нет то проще будет подключаться через сеть (127.0.0.1).
Применительно к mysql, как правило, localhost это не псевдоним 127.0.0.1, а подключение через unix-сокет.

MrClon ★★★★★ 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.